    I put all my peppers in a steamer and steam for 10 minutes then run them through a tomato sauce maker. Works very well :) removes the seeds and skins leaves the pulp an some liquid of the pepper. You could add your veggies and fruits to the steamer after you brown them if you like. Then run it all through the sauce maker. I then measure it and go 1/3 to 1/2 vinegar or bottled lemon juice for some of that if want to tame the vinegar taste. Example: if 1cup of pepper sauce add 1/3 to 1/2 cup or go by taste.
